> >>> hmm, I recently discovered that normal user space headers always define
> >>> both __LITTLE_ENDIAN and __BIG_ENDIAN so therefore a
> >>> # ifdef __LITTLE_ENDIAN
> >>> #  define DO_CRC(x) crc = tab[(crc ^ (x)) & 255] ^ (crc >> 8)
> >>> # else
> >>> #  define DO_CRC(x) crc = tab[((crc >> 24) ^ (x)) & 255] ^ (crc << 8)
> >>> # endif
> >>>
> >>> Wont work. One have to use
> >>>  #if __BYTE_ORDER == __LITTLE_ENDIAN
> >>> instead.

> This appears to work for me on my big endian PowerPC target.  Perhaps
> somebody with a little endian target can verify it does not break their
> env tools.
>
> diff --git a/lib_generic/crc32.c b/lib_generic/crc32.c
> index 468b397..27335a3 100644
> --- a/lib_generic/crc32.c
> +++ b/lib_generic/crc32.c
> @@ -163,7 +163,7 @@ const uint32_t * ZEXPORT get_crc_table()
>   #endif
>
>   /*
> ========================================================================= */
> -# ifdef __LITTLE_ENDIAN
> +# if __BYTE_ORDER == __LITTLE_ENDIAN
>   #  define DO_CRC(x) crc = tab[(crc ^ (x)) & 255] ^ (crc >> 8)
>   # else
>   #  define DO_CRC(x) crc = tab[((crc >> 24) ^ (x)) & 255] ^ (crc << 8)


I THINK this will work. Looking at include/linux/byteorder/big_endian.h it says:
#define	__BYTE_ORDER	__BIG_ENDIAN
so it seems like the __BYTE_ORDER logic is in place in u-boot.
Someone with a LE CPU should confirm this.
